Princesshay, Exeter

The Princesshay scheme represents the biggest single investment in regeneration in Exeter’s history. This will deliver a unique and vibrant city centre scheme that will substantially benefit Exeter and enhance its reputation as the region’s capital city. The redevelopment of the city centre covered 13 acres of the Princesshay area.
The construction works include fifty new shops - including the flagship, Debenhams department store for which MJN Colston carried out some fit-out works. There is also 130 apartments, restaurants, and a 320 space car park. MJN Colston, together with WSP Group plc, were responsible for the development of the design, and the installation of, the Mechanical, Electrical, Public Health and Sprinkler services.
